The Getchell Mine: A Pioneering Force in Modern Gold and Silver Mining
Getchell Mine, located in northern Nevada, stands as one of the most significant gold and silver mines in the United States. Owned and operated by Nevada Gold Mines—a joint venture comprising the industry giants Barrick Gold Corporation and Newmont Corporation—the Getchell operation exemplifies the utmost in modern mining advancements. Getchell Mine Geological and Operational Overview
The Getchell Mine is situated within the prolific Battle Mountain – Eureka mineral trend in northern Nevada. This area is renowned for rich gold and silver deposits and has been mined since the 1980s, producing millions of ounces of precious metals.
Geological Highlights: Carlin-Type Disseminated Gold Deposits
- ✔ Deposit Type: Microscopic gold particles finely distributed throughout sedimentary rock formations
- 📊 Ore Bodies: Formed within disseminated, widespread deposits requiring sophisticated extraction
- ⚠ Key Challenge: Conventional detection methods struggle to locate these microscopic particles, demanding advanced processing
- ✔ Production Methods: Both surface (open-pit) and underground mining activities are optimized to access varying depths for maximum yield
- 📊 Processing Technologies: Use of crushing, grinding, heap leaching, and evolving cyanide-based recovery techniques for gold extraction
Key Processes at Getchell Mine
- Conventional Crushing & Grinding: Essential for liberating gold particles from host rock
- Heap Leaching: Allows scalable and environmentally manageable gold extraction
- Cyanide Recovery: Ongoing refinements increase safety and reduce impact
- Open-Pit & Underground Integration: Dual methods to optimize resource extraction and limit disturbance
